Job Description

Job Summary:

The Pharmacist In Charge (Name on Pharmacy License) is responsible for the daily operation of the pharmacy and to assure compliance with the laws governing the operation of a pharmacy per the State Board of Pharmacy. Under indirect supervision consults with patients and medical personnel regarding medication therapy. Provides direction to Pharmacist Residents, Pharmacist Interns, Pharmacy Technicians, and non-licensed personnel.  Dispenses, compounds, procures, stores, and distributes pharmacy products.  Provides medical personnel and patients with medication information and product identification. Performs other duties as required.

Essential Responsibilities:


  • Assures compliance with all regulation and laws as required by the State Board of Pharmacy and other regulatory agencies as it applies to the daily operation of the pharmacy where prescriptions and compounds are dispensed.

  • Provides direction to staff members

  • Interviews patients to obtain information regarding drug use, drug allergies and sensitivities and documents the information to appropriate records of the pharmacy information system; advises patients verbally and with written materials on significant precautions, proper drug therapy and administration, the use of related devices and the coordination of drug therapy with diet, according to established policies and procedures.

  • Reviews and interprets prescription orders and verifies accuracy and completeness of patient labeling and input into pharmacy information system.

  • Dispenses, compounds, procures, stores and distributes pharmaceuticals and pharmacy products, including antineoplastics and/or other sterile products as required, according to legal requirements, established policies and procedures, and accepted professional standards of practice.

  • Evaluates and resolves real or potential drug therapy problems related to interpretation of prescriptions, drug furnishing irregularities, service complaints and issues such as drug procurement or equipment problems, according to established policies and procedures.

  • Confers with medical personnel concerning care and treatment of patients, related critical diagnoses, drug dosage, interactions, dosage forms, and other factors which might influence the course of treatment and the activity medications; suggests changes in drug therapy and/or use, as appropriate to assure optimum therapeutic results and cost effective prescribing.

  • Maintains work area and equipment in an organized and clean condition; maintains a safe and efficient work environment.
